Major differences between them are (sure we missed a few):
1964.5
Push button auto (when not 4 speed or console floor shift)
Bolt on wipers
Fender emblem long tail
Valiant emblem on the back
Individual gauges on right
Ball and trunnion driveshaft
1965
Column shift auto
Clip on wipers
Fender emblem short tail
Two gauge binnacles, small gauges all together in one circle
Slip yoke driveshaft, B&T on 4 speed only

Obscure 1964.5 vs 1965 difference: Firewall stamping below and to the passenger side of the heater motor has a right angle in 1964. For 1965, firewall stamping bumps are extended, almost touching the heater motor.

A couple more: 1965 radio has rectangular channel selection push buttons. 1964 has round push buttons. Heater controls on a 1964 pull out/push into the dash. On a 1965, they move left and right.

Mustang vs Barracuda production: Mustang Barracuda 1964 - 121,000 23,000 1965 - 559,000 64,000 1966 - 607,000 38,000 TOTAL 1.28 mil 125,000 Mustangs out sold Barracudas 10:1 (on average) So the Barracuda is "rare".
